Output 62c4f5cd326d64f3e119b598aea128c4a6bb864c6b919b52fec0fd542af963f9:0

value
31796552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bcc9fd4107622588b83f0ffe183a1df624b5a51 OP_EQUAL
address
3QeQfEvWH6PTfB6ohdasvp6nMU14hj2CVe
transaction
62c4f5cd326d64f3e119b598aea128c4a6bb864c6b919b52fec0fd542af963f9
spent
true